Pavia. During the Christmas holidays a council house in Sicily avenue seems to have turned into a hellish place. At least that's what we learn from the account given by the newspaper La Provincia Pavese , that the January 8, 2011 devotes an entire page [1] from December 27 in the house no longer sleep because the sudden succession of small fires that forced the occupants to continue patrols and shifts of exhausting vigil.
The case, however, similar to those that occurred in 2004 in Sicily in the town of Canneto di Caronia, is extremely interesting, at least from what is told by the newspaper bunting. The situation of the family, consisting of a middle-aged woman and two children, seems to be unsolvable and without explanation. Fires have been developed for several days and several times a day even before the experts came to make sure the events. In fact that house you are interested Firefighters with assistance from the core of NBC Milano, ARPA, police science, some experts at the University of Pavia, and even the church.
The Harp, the fire brigade and the police have collected tissue samples from burned and carried out environmental measures, but everything is normal. Two priests, convened by the same owner, have blessed the premises and invited the people to prayer. As it has done for

All the fires that developed in the house concerned highly flammable material (clothes in cupboards, or a phone book), but fortunately have always been discovered in time by the smell of burning and did not lead to serious consequences. These appear to be fairly tried by the patrol shifts that have forced some ten days, but the only time the house is left unattended for a couple of hours fortunately no fire occurred.
interview the lady we also discover that in fact none of them have never seen a fire grow from nothing, you are always noticed the phenomenon because of the intense burning smell came into the room of origin and have always observed a flame already developed.
There are shown the plastic bags full of clothing scorched and still wet the water used to extinguish the flames. These T-shirts, socks, jackets and even blankets (all synthetic fibers, it seems). We also observe the cabinet doors charred at some of these fires. Burns are quite deep but localized, from twenty to forty centimeters wide.

Come è noto, si tratterebbe di un presunto fenomeno paranormale, caratterizzato da vistosi manifestazioni fisiche: generalmente movimenti misteriosi of objects, noises and small fires. The technical term in English is RSPK (recurrent spontaneous psychokinesis ) and always seems to be related to the presence of a particular person rather than a place. In the latter case, the infestation will be of parapsychologists.
The interpretation given by those who believe in the reality of paranormal phenomena is that these cases are just manifestations of the psychic energies of the people involved (often teenagers with psychological problems) [3]. Skeptics are wont to find out more mundane causes such as vibrations that move objects [4-5], practical jokes or direct human intervention [6-7], noise caused by animali, tubazioni, contrazioni termiche, eccetera.
